🔧 Oxygen Sensor - Replacement
Assumption: this guide covers replacing either oxygen sensor on your Fusion: the upstream sensor before the catalytic converter or the downstream sensor after the catalytic converter. The upstream sensor helps control fuel mixture, while the downstream sensor checks catalytic converter performance.
Difficulty Level: Beginner | Estimated Time: 1-2 hours
⚠️ Safety & Precautions
- ⚠️ Let the exhaust cool completely before touching anything; oxygen sensors thread into very hot exhaust parts.
- ⚠️ Work on level ground and support your Fusion with jack stands if you need access underneath.
- ⚠️ Never rely on a floor jack alone. A floor jack lifts the car; jack stands safely hold it up.
- ⚠️ Disconnect the negative battery cable if your hands will be near the starter, alternator wiring, or tight engine-bay wiring.
- ⚠️ Do not use anti-seize on the sensor tip. Most new sensors already have coating on the threads only.
🔧 Required Tools
You'll need the following tools for this repair:
- 7/8-inch oxygen sensor socket
- 3/8-inch drive ratchet
- 3/8-inch drive 6-inch extension
- 10mm socket
- 8mm socket
- Flat-head screwdriver
- Trim clip removal tool
- Torque wrench 3/8-inch drive
- OBD-II scan tool
- Penetrating oil
- Floor jack rated 2-ton minimum
- Jack stands rated 2-ton minimum
- Wheel chocks
- Nitrile gloves
- Safety glasses

📋 Before You Begin
- Park your Fusion on level ground, shift to Park, and set the parking brake.
- Use wheel chocks behind the rear wheels before lifting the front of the car.
- Let the exhaust cool for at least 1 hour if the engine was recently running.
- Use an OBD-II scan tool to read the trouble code before replacing the sensor. Sensor 1 means upstream; Sensor 2 means downstream.
- Spray penetrating oil on the oxygen sensor threads and let it soak for 10-15 minutes.
🔨 Step-by-Step Instructions
Follow these steps in order:
Step 1: Identify Which Sensor You Are Replacing
- Use an OBD-II scan tool to read the stored diagnostic code.
- Bank 1 Sensor 1 is the upstream sensor, mounted before the catalytic converter near the turbo/exhaust outlet area.
- Bank 1 Sensor 2 is the downstream sensor, mounted after the catalytic converter underneath the vehicle.
- An OBD-II scan tool plugs into the diagnostic port under the dash and reads fault codes from the car’s computers.
- Match the code before buying parts.
Step 2: Raise and Secure the Vehicle if Needed
- Use wheel chocks behind the rear wheels.
- Use a floor jack rated 2-ton minimum to lift the front of your Fusion at the front jacking point.
- Place jack stands rated 2-ton minimum under the approved front support points.
- Gently lower the vehicle onto the jack stands.
- Keep the floor jack lightly touching the jacking point as backup.
Step 3: Remove the Lower Splash Shield if Blocking Access
- Use an 8mm socket to remove the lower splash shield screws.
- Use a trim clip removal tool or flat-head screwdriver to remove plastic clips.
- Set the shield and fasteners aside in order.
- A trim clip tool is a small fork-shaped tool that removes plastic clips without breaking them.
Step 4: Disconnect the Oxygen Sensor Electrical Connector
- Put on safety glasses and nitrile gloves.
- Follow the oxygen sensor wire from the sensor body to its connector.
- Use your fingers to press the connector lock tab and unplug it.
- If the lock is stuck, use a flat-head screwdriver gently to release the tab.
- Do not pull on the wires.
- Pull the connector, not the wire.
Step 5: Remove Any Heat Shield if Needed
- If a heat shield blocks access, use a 10mm socket to remove the shield fasteners.
- Move the heat shield just enough to access the sensor.
- Do not bend the shield into the exhaust or wiring.
Step 6: Remove the Old Oxygen Sensor
- Place the 7/8-inch oxygen sensor socket over the sensor wire and onto the sensor hex.
- Attach a 3/8-inch drive ratchet and 3/8-inch drive 6-inch extension if more reach is needed.
- Turn counterclockwise to loosen the sensor.
- If it is tight, apply more penetrating oil and wait a few minutes.
- Remove the sensor by hand after it breaks loose.
- An oxygen sensor socket has a slot in the side so the sensor wire can pass through it.
Step 7: Compare the New Sensor
- Compare the old and new sensors side by side.
- Make sure the connector shape, wire length, and sensor style match.
- Do not touch the tip of the new sensor with oily fingers.
- If the new sensor has thread coating already applied, do not add extra anti-seize.
Step 8: Install the New Oxygen Sensor
- Start the new sensor by hand to avoid cross-threading.
- Use the 7/8-inch oxygen sensor socket and torque wrench 3/8-inch drive to tighten it.
- Torque to 48 Nm (35 ft-lbs).
- If access prevents using a torque wrench, tighten until fully seated and snug, but do not over-tighten.
- Hand-start threads every time.
Step 9: Reconnect the Electrical Connector
- Route the sensor wire the same way the original was routed.
- Keep the wire away from the exhaust pipe, catalytic converter, axle, and steering components.
- Push the connector together until it clicks.
- Use the original wire clips or holders to secure the harness.
Step 10: Reinstall Shields and Lower the Vehicle
- Use a 10mm socket to reinstall any heat shield fasteners.
- Use an 8mm socket to reinstall the lower splash shield screws.
- Use a trim clip removal tool or your fingers to reinstall plastic clips.
- Use the floor jack rated 2-ton minimum to lift slightly off the jack stands.
- Remove the jack stands rated 2-ton minimum.
- Lower your Fusion slowly to the ground.
Step 11: Clear Codes and Check Operation
- Use the OBD-II scan tool to clear the oxygen sensor fault code.
- Start the engine and let it idle.
- Listen for exhaust leaks near the sensor area.
- Confirm the check engine light stays off after a short drive.
✅ After Repair
- Drive your Fusion for 10-20 minutes with mixed city and steady-speed driving.
- Use the OBD-II scan tool to check that no oxygen sensor codes return.
- If a code returns immediately, inspect the connector, wire routing, and fuse condition before replacing more parts.
- If the old sensor was stuck badly, recheck for exhaust leaks after the first full heat cycle.
💰 DIY vs Shop Cost
Shop Cost: $250-$550 per sensor, depending on sensor location and labor time
DIY Cost: $60-$220 per sensor, parts only
You Save: $150-$330 by doing it yourself!
Shop labor rates vary but typically run $100-$150/hour. This repair takes a shop approximately 0.8-1.5 hours.
